On 2014-01-29 the FDA classified a Class II recall of ESTRADIOL, Tablet, 0.5 mg, Rx only, Distributed by: AidaPak Service, LLC, NDC 00555089902 by Aidapak Services, citing labeling: Label Mixup: ESTRADIOL, Tablet, 0.5 mg may have potentially been mislabeled as the following drug: NICOTINE POLACRILEX, GUM, 2 mg, NDC 00536302923, Pedigree: AD33897_28,….
